1:08-2:00 is such a great example of how acting and sound design can impact a scene and the audience's view of the characters. The song "Maniac" is playing in the background when we learn that Carol has been thinking about murdering Debbie for a while but hasn't acted on it yet (it is more fantasy than reality in her notebook). It isn't until Barb offers a serious perspective of how to kill Debbie (1:40) that both girls' insanity and willingness to actually murder Debbie is apparent to the audience. As the music swells right before the chorus (1:45), Carol's reaction shows the audience that the threat is now real and her desire to commit the murder is actually going to be fulfilled. The chorus "She's a maniac" also plays directly after both girls have decided Debbie's fate. The humming scene (6:33) which recalls the chorus demonstrates not only their mental state and lack of empathy for Debbie but also has the added importance of marking Debbie's last performance with the last moments of her life. Such amazing acting from all of these ladies!

I love the foreshadowing of the whole first scene. They start talking about how they want to kill her own sister while the song "Maniac" is playing low in the background, and at 1:43 when Barb gives her the idea of everything being just 'an accident' the camera focuses Carol and the song is becoming louder. Just at the part of "On a wire between will and what will be. She's a maniac" and at the end of the flashback, Barb ends humming the song. Telling us that they turned into "Maniacs"
